Images of Japanese Woodcuts from the collection of The Fitzwilliam Museum A selection of colourful and striking woodblock prints from the ukiyo-e or 'floating world' genre, by master artists including Tsokioka Yoshitoshi and Utagawa Kunisada. THE UNIVERSITY OF CAMBRIDGE'S MUSEUMS AND COLLECTIONS ARE FOR EVERYONE Together, the eight University of Cambridge Museums and its Botanic Garden represent the UK's highest concentration of internationally important collections outside of London. With more than five million works of art, artefacts, and specimens, the collections have supported nearly 300 years of investigation into the world around us Founded in 1978 Fitzwilliam Museum Enterprises has drawn upon the world class collections of the Fitzwilliam for over forty years, raising money to support the museum and keep it free for all to access
